What does a senior field service engineer do?

Senior Field Service Engineers are responsible for the installation, repair, and maintenance of equipment. Their duties include installing equipment that complies with technical specifications, coordinating preventative maintenance, calibrating tools, test equipment, manage the contract tendering process, and conduct field modifications. They also assist in the ordering of repair parts as well as organizing service records and customer logs. Senior Filed Service Engineers works to ensure that work deliverable adheres to all regulatory requirements and health and safety protocols.

  3. Make a budget

    Including a salary range in the senior field service engineer job description is a good way to get more applicants. A senior field service engineer salary can be affected by several factors, such as the location of the job, the level of experience, education, certifications, and the employer's prestige.

    For example, the average salary for a senior field service engineer in Indiana may be lower than in California, and an entry-level engineer typically earns less than a senior-level senior field service engineer. Additionally, a senior field service engineer with lots of experience in the field may command a higher salary as a result.

    Average senior field service engineer salary

    $87,414yearly

    $42.03 hourly rate

    Entry-level senior field service engineer salary
    $66,000 yearly salary

    Average senior field service engineer salary by state

    RankStateAvg. salaryHourly rate
    1California$125,681$60
    2Arizona$99,914$48
    3Oregon$95,431$46
    4New Mexico$94,396$45
    5Washington$92,207$44
    6Maryland$91,697$44
    7Texas$88,894$43
    8Massachusetts$86,015$41
    9New York$85,488$41
    10Illinois$83,213$40
    11Colorado$82,881$40
    12Georgia$81,157$39
    13South Carolina$80,516$39
    14North Carolina$80,201$39
    15Alabama$79,443$38
    16Florida$78,701$38
    17Minnesota$78,190$38
    18New Jersey$76,497$37
    19Pennsylvania$75,360$36
    20Ohio$72,844$35

    Senior field service engineer job description example

    At Nautilus, we have a big and important mission: improve the health of millions by unleashing the potential of the proteome to accelerate drug development and enable a new world of precision and personalized medicine. We are developing a single-molecule protein analysis platform of unprecedented sensitivity, scale, and ease of use that we believe will democratize access to the proteome - one of the most dynamic and valuable sources of biological insight. To accomplish this, we are pursuing deep, hard science with an entrepreneurial mindset and creating a world-class team of builders, innovators, and dreamers across a wide range of disciplines.

    We are hiring for a Sr. Field Service Engineer to join our growing team. As a Field Service Engineer, you will perform installations, troubleshooting, instrument repairs, and preventative maintenance on our Proteomic Analysis System, both on internal and external, customer-installed instruments. You will work closely with our Systems Integration, Engineering, and Software functions to develop deep knowledge of the system and experimental workflow.

    This position will report to the Field Service Engineer Senior Manager and is located in San Carlos, CA.

    ResponsibilitiesMaintain, install, and repair Nautilus products at both internal and external customer sites Work independently to resolve all assigned customer and technical issues Perform validation services (IQ/OQ) of hardware and software Identify, analyze, and diagnose product complaints at customer's location Act as customer advocate to ensure usability and training Complete necessary administrative duties such as logging and reporting of service activities, expense reporting, inventory, etc.

    Requirements5+ years of relevant experience working in the service & support of complex instrumentation is required Associate's degree (A.S./A.A.S.) or Bachelor's degree (B.S./B.A.) in Life Sciences, Physics, Engineering, Mechatronics, or equivalent experience (e.g. Military Certificates in electronics) is required with domain knowledge in one or more of the following areas: optics (lasers), fluidics, and/or motion control is highly desired Prior experience servicing complex life science instruments is required Prior experience as a field service engineer and deep familiarity with the processes/ techniques involved Demonstrated experience in troubleshooting and following problem-solving procedures Excellent verbal and written communication and interpersonal skills Proficient knowledge of electrical and electromechanical technology and all required safety protocols Ability to multi-task and prioritize is required The ability and willingness to lift up to 50 lbs Possess the ability to walk, stand, carry materials, stoop, kneel, and bend at the waist Up to 70% travel required A valid driver's license and passport Knowledge of hand tools and proper usage, including a digital multimeter

  7. Send a job offer and onboard your new senior field service engineer

    Once you have selected a candidate for the senior field service engineer position, it is time to create an offer letter. In addition to salary, the offer letter should include details about benefits and perks that are available to the employee. Ensuring your offer is competitive is vital, as qualified candidates may be considering other job opportunities. The candidate may wish to negotiate the terms of the offer, and it is important to be open to discussion and reach a mutually beneficial agreement. After the offer has been accepted, it is a good idea to formalize the agreement with a contract.

    It's also important to follow up with applicants who do not get the job with an email letting them know that the position is filled.

    After that, you can create an onboarding schedule for a new senior field service engineer. Human Resources and the hiring manager should complete Employee Action Forms. Human Resources should also ensure that onboarding paperwork is completed, including I-9s, benefits enrollment, federal and state tax forms, etc., and that new employee files are created.
